(Fargo, ND) -- The increase in gas prices are having a direct effect on transit systems in the Fargo Moorhead area. 

MATBUS says they have seen a 19 percent increase in ridership over the past six weeks. They cite a similar scenario occurring during 2008, where they saw a 12 percent rise in ticket sales and ridership. 

North Dakota gas prices have risen more than 60 cents compared to their averages a month ago. Regular gas prices in the state are sitting at $3.87 per gallon, with mid and premium prices costing close to 50 cents more per gallon.
